【问题标题】:Setting username, password and signature in Paypal REST api [closed]在 Paypal REST api 中设置用户名、密码和签名 [关闭]
【发布时间】:2013-07-07 17:30:35
【问题描述】:

我对经典的 Paypal API 有点熟悉,但我正在尝试为 REST API 找出一些东西。我浏览了文档,但找不到任何东西

  1. 使用 REST API,我是否可以像使用经典 API 一样设置用户名、密码和签名来转移资金,还是完全基于 client_id 和 secret?

  2. 我正在使用的软件有点像一个有买家和卖家的市场。如果我不能使用个人卖家的用户名、密码和签名,是否有其他方式来处理买家和卖家之间的付款,让卖家不必注册开发者账户来获取自己的client_id和secret?

  3. 考虑到信用卡是一种支付方式,我认为这意味着我不必重定向到 Paypal 的网站来处理此问题,这与经典 API 不同。对吗?

我在 paypal 的网站上看到了 PHP 的 this codesames,但我想知道是否有更深入的示例。有人知道paypal REST API 的好教程吗?

对于那些投反对票的人,您能否指出文档中明确回答了我的问题的任何地方?

【问题讨论】:

    标签: php paypal paypal-sandbox


    【解决方案1】:
    1. PayPal REST API 仅使用 OAuth 2.0 进行身份验证,因此您需要提供客户端 ID 和密码,并调用 OAuth 端点以检索访问令牌以在后续调用中使用。
    2. 目前无法通过 REST API 做到这一点。
    3. 正确,REST API 不需要对信用卡用例进行重定向。

    关于示例,有多种不同语言的 SDK,其中包括示例应用程序。您有什么特别要寻找的东西吗?

    【讨论】:

    • 感谢您的帮助。这似乎对我不起作用。我做了更多的搜索,我想我会通过像balanced 这样的服务。当然,我可以四处搜索,可能会找到其他一些,但是根据您的经验,您是否碰巧知道这样的优质服务?再次感谢。
    • 您可以使用为您描述的用例明确构建的 PayPal Adaptive Payments API。
    • 是的,但如果我理解正确的话,这不适用于 REST API,如 here 所述
    猜你喜欢
    • 2015-03-13
    • 2016-05-30
    • 2014-07-18
    • 2013-06-05
    • 2013-06-05
    • 1970-01-01
    • 2020-10-27
    • 2012-07-11
    • 2011-12-02
    相关资源
    最近更新 更多